If you click on the thumbnail when it appears, the recording will open, which will allow you to edit the video. You can change the location where it’s saved, open the recording in a specific app, or delete the recording. You can also insert it into an email or document by dragging it into an open window.įor even more options, hit control and click the thumbnail. To move the recording to another location, drag the thumbnail to your desired folder. If you swipe the thumbnail to the right or do nothing, your recording will automatically save as a QuickTime movie (MOV) in the location you’ve set.
